That does look cool, but just as a heads-up, i recently found a concern with hugo and its reliance on an outdated and unmaintained version of mmark: https://github.com/gohugoio/hugo/issues/5124 Now, it's quite possible that ikiwiki has comparable problems (i haven't looked into it), so i don't want to suggest that tail making such a switch would be strictly worse, but from what i can see, hugo does have a vaguely-bad "smell" to it given this ecosystem stagnation. thanks for your efforts in thinking about this tooling. the attention and care taken on Tails documentation is very much appreciated. --dkg
